Transaction 93455421339574f81488c619b994dde9cdc721a340b81221a21da453b9d0cec4

1 Input
2 Outputs
  • 93455421339574f81488c619b994dde9cdc721a340b81221a21da453b9d0cec4:0
  • value  500000000
    address  388NZ3TaC14ch68PpTSNZQvRQ74xakPSfF
  • 93455421339574f81488c619b994dde9cdc721a340b81221a21da453b9d0cec4:1
  • value  149996670
    address  3DpbtG4UzVnTvCvnWiLhu9ZkgZXvgsMr1C